Understanding the Importance of Cost Reduction in Design
In today’s competitive market, every business strives to optimize costs without compromising on quality.
The design stage is a crucial phase where substantial cost savings can be achieved.
Small and medium-sized manufacturers play a pivotal role in this process.
Their proposal capabilities can lead to significant reductions in production costs.
During the design phase, adjustments and changes are more manageable and less expensive compared to later stages.
If cost-reduction strategies are effectively implemented at this stage, it can lead to a more efficient production process and a cost-effective end product.
By incorporating expert insights from manufacturers early on, companies can pre-emptively avoid potential cost and quality issues.
The Role of Small and Medium-Sized Manufacturers
Small and medium-sized manufacturers often have flexible operations which enable them to collaborate closely with designers.
They possess unique insights that can identify cost-saving opportunities that might be overlooked by larger companies.
Their ability to adapt and innovate can significantly aid in refining designs to enhance efficiency and cost-effectiveness.
Such manufacturers offer bespoke solutions, bringing new perspectives and techniques to the table.
By partnering with them, businesses can leverage their expertise in materials, processes, and technologies to drive down costs.
This collaborative approach allows for the development of products that meet quality standards while staying within budget.
Examples of Cost Reduction at the Design Stage
Material Selection
One of the most effective strategies for reducing costs is selecting the right materials.
Small and medium-sized manufacturers often have deep knowledge of various materials and can suggest alternatives that are more cost-effective without sacrificing quality.
For example, replacing a high-cost alloy with a more affordable composite could achieve the desired performance at a lower price.
Design Simplification
Simplifying a design can lead to reduced manufacturing complexity and costs.
Manufacturers can examine the design and suggest simplifications that preserve functionality while reducing the number of components or steps involved.
This not only reduces production time but also lowers the chance of errors.
Process Optimization
Experienced manufacturers can offer insights into optimizing existing production processes.
They might propose altering the sequence of operations or using different machinery to improve efficiency.
Such process enhancements lead to faster production times and less waste, which translates into cost savings.
Prototype Development
By collaborating with manufacturers during prototype development, companies can explore numerous cost-reduction opportunities.
Manufacturers can identify potential manufacturing issues early on and suggest changes.
This iterative process helps in refining the product before mass production, thereby avoiding costly revisions later.
Benefits of Early Manufacturer Collaboration
Engaging small and medium-sized manufacturers from the onset of the design phase fosters a collaborative environment.
This partnership offers several benefits, including faster time-to-market, improved product quality, and reduced financial risk.
During early collaboration, manufacturers can provide input on feasibility and cost implications of design choices.
This proactive approach ensures that any design adjustments are incorporated upfront, sidestepping expensive modifications during production.
Real-World Success Stories
Various companies have successfully implemented cost-reduction strategies at the design stage with the help of small and medium-sized manufacturers.
For instance, a consumer electronics firm partnered with a local manufacturer to streamline their product casing.
By switching to a new material and optimizing the mold design, they reduced production costs by 20%.
Another example is a furniture company that collaborated with a small manufacturer to redesign their assembly process.
The new approach, which involved fewer components and an efficient assembly line, resulted in a 15% cost reduction per unit.
